Julie Cox Biography


Born in the United Kingdom, Julie Cox has traveled extensively since the age of seven. She has lived in Indonesia, Australia, the Middle East and France. She has worked across the globe and is fluent in English, French and Sign Language.

Cox starred in a number of British and American film and television productions, among them King of Texas, which premieres on TNT in June; and the British films War Bride and Angel for May. She also starred in Film Four's Death of Klinghoffer, based on the opera composed by John Adams.

Among her other television acting credits are David Copperfield for Hallmark; and Tears Before Bedtime and The Scarlet Pimpernel, both for the BBC. Cox is no stranger to the SF genre in the acting craft: she starred in 20,000 Leagues Under the Sea, for Hallmark, and appeared on the American TV series Tales from the Crypt.

Her feature-film credits include Allegria, with the Cirque du Soleil; Woundings; and La Vie de Marianne for France's Arte. Cox also starred in the British production It's A Wonderful Life, which garnered both an Oscar and a BAFTA for Best Short Film.
